Send us a text New Year's resolutions promise change, but for many in addiction recovery, they often reinforce fear and a sense of failure. In this episode, we talk about why starting over every January doesn't work, and what does. Instead of chasing big resolutions, we focus on strengthening the routines that already support recovery. Episode 36: When the Past Still Hurts
Send us a text Our unwanted behaviors don’t come from nowhere. In this episode, Sean and Dayne unpack how childhood wounds, emotional neglect, abuse, and unmet needs lay the groundwork for compulsive sexual behavior and addiction. We explore how triggers are often echoes of unhealed pain—and why healing doesn’t mean living in the past, but learning not to be controlled by it.
